Senators are usually elected by voters to represent the people in a State or Federal Senate.
- The Senator belongs to the legislative arm
- The Senator debates & votes on bills and amendments and also scrutinizes and closely examines the executive government.
- The Senator have a responsibility to check the power of the President and State Governor.
- The Federal Senators check the power of the federal head while the State Senators check that of state head.
